Ron is a "stabilizer."  He's the guy you hire when your last hire left the place in ashes.  He can bring stability, get the players on the same page, and put things back on the rails.  Fox was the same type.  They are not the guys who are going to get a team to the next level (unless the team is overwhelmingly talented), but they can fix an organization's mess.

Parcells is of that same bent, only he had the ability to get a team to the next level after sweeping up the ashes.

As long as there are coaching disasters that leave teams a complete mess, there will be a need for coaches like Rivera.  Think Denver after the McDaniels' reign of terror.  They are like calling ServPro: they aren't going to turn your house into some dream home, but they will clean up the mess and put it back into the shape it was before the disaster.

And honestly, with the mess in DC, both the way the team was when he took over and the owner thinking he is some sort of mob boss, Rivera is probably the perfect guy to keep the team focused.

Ron is old school. Like Fox. He will drag a game out and wear teams down. Sometimes it doesn’t end up in his favor and sometimes it does. 

Ron even said in his interview after signing with the Redskins that he did not really adjust or scheme. Meaning there is no creativity or exposing mismatches. He lines up 1v1 and hopes he’s coached his guys to win the matchup. Sometimes he does not. It’s almost identical mindset to Fox.

I think Cam had more to do with 2015 than anything. With the right roster Ron’s coaching will work. It will never been so consistent though. Ron is a decent coach but he will always be mediocre. If this was the early to late 90s, he’d probably have a couple rings by now.
